Apache is a free and open-source cross-platform web server software.
BuddyPress is designed to allow schools, companies, sports teams, or any other niche community to start their own social network or communication tool.
jQuery is a JavaScript library which is a free, open-source software designed to simplify HTML DOM tree traversal and manipulation, as well as event handling, CSS animation, and Ajax.
PHP is a general-purpose scripting language used for web development.
The Events Calendar is a free event management plugin for WordPress.
Twenty Fourteen is the default WordPress theme for 2014.
Varnish is a reverse caching proxy.
WordPress is a free and open-source content management system written in PHP and paired with a MySQL or MariaDB database. Features include a plugin architecture and a template system.
